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Glenn Trueman made an unannounced visit to the facility and explained the reason for the visit.
The purpose of the visit is to follow up on the SOC 341 submitted by the facility in regards to staff slapping a client.
The initial visit was conducted on 02/02/2023 and included the following:
Interview was conducted with Program Manager Zeke Meza at 1:50 P.M.
Files for Client C1 and Client C2 were reviewed. ID page, IPP and Physician's Report for C1 were submitted.
ID page and Physician's Report were submitted for C 2.
File was reviewed for Staff S 1. Personnel Record for S 1 was submitted.
Interviews were conducted with Staff S 2 and S 3 at 2:30 P.M.
City Of El Monte Police Department Case # 23-003267 submitted at visit.
At today's visit Staff S 4 was interviewed. Attempt was made to interview Client C1 who is non-verbal and didn't respond to questioning and immediately left the interview room not wanting to be interviewed.
In regards to the SOC 341 submitted it was determined on interviews with staff that Staff S 2 and Staff S 4 both observed Staff S 1 smack Client C1 in the mouth with an open hand and that it was hard contact making a loud sound. Stated loud enough to make C 1's head go back. C1 had taken off her mask.
Also was stated that S 1 pushed C1's chair hard back into the cubicle.
Both S2 and S4 reported the incident immediately to their supervisor.
Based on interviews conducted and information gathered personal rights deficiency cited on 809 D.

Exit interview conducted.

Personal Rights
Each client shall have personal rights which include, but are not limited to, the following:
To be free from corporal or unusual punishment, infliction of pain, humiliation, intimidation, ridicule, coercion, threat, mental abuse, or other actions of a punitive nature, including but not limited to: interference with the daily living functions, including eating, sleeping, or toileting; or withholding of shelter, clothing, medication, or aids to physical functioning.
